Description

Illustrated, Leather Binding

A lovely early edition of this collection of plays with notes from Elizabeth Inchbald in half morocco bindings and paper covered boards. 

Twenty five volumes complete bound in eight. Undated, dated from Jisc. 

Densely illustrated with a monochrome plate frontispiece to each play. Collated, complete. 

Volume I includes A New Way to Pay Old Debts by Philip Massinger, The Count of Narbonne by Robert Jephson, The Stranger by Benjamin Thompson, De Monfort by Joanna Baillie, and The Point of Honour by Charles Kemble.

Volume II includes Wild Oats, The Castle of Andalusia, and Fontainbleau by John O'Keeffe, with The Road to Ruin and The Deserted Daughter by Thomas Holcroft.

Volume III includes The Heiress by General Burgoyne, Know Your Own Mind by Arthur Murphy, Honey Moon by John Tobin, Belle's Stratagem and A Bold Stroke for a Husband by Mrs Cowley.

Volume IV includes The Wheel of Fortune, First Love, and The Jew by Richard Cumberland, and The Duenna and The Rivals by Richard Brinsley Sheridan.

Volume V includes Lovers Vows, Such Things Are, Every One Has His Fault, Wives as They Were, and To Marry or Not to Marry by Mrs Inchbald.

Volume VI includes Speed the Plough, The Way to Get Married, A Cure for the Heart Ache, The School of Reform by Thomas Morton, and The Dramatist by Frederick Reynolds. 

Volume VII includes The Battle of Hexam, The Heir at Law, The Iron Chest, and The Mountaineers by George Colman.

Volume VIII includes Inkle and Yarico, The Surrender of Calais, The Poor Gentleman, and John Bull by George Colman.

Prior owner's book plates to the first pastedowns. From the library of C. Ibbetson.

Condition

In half morocco bindings and paper covered boards. Externally, smart. There is some rubbing to the heads and tails of the spines and to the extremities. There are some light marks to the boards. Prior owner's book plates to the first pastedowns. Internally, firmly bound. The pages are bright and clean with some age toning and the odd spot.

Very Good
